Transaction cd86afba55b6db37620a1b193b053768a493eed7cff824cb73e3dfed12ec6d50

4 Input
1 Outputs
  • cd86afba55b6db37620a1b193b053768a493eed7cff824cb73e3dfed12ec6d50:0
  • value  24950000
    address  12X6coizvkEVfgmMYvdVqxBsvTJ9p3AJpW